T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2020 in Review

2,595 of the 5,652 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in AT&T (T) for Q4 2020, worth a combined $107B — up 0.59% from $107B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 326 funds opened new T positions and 111 closed out — a net gain of 215 holders — while 922 added to existing stakes and 1,209 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Ensign Peak Advisors, adding an estimated $204M. The largest seller was Bank of America, cutting an estimated $315M.
